Railway statistics 2025

Rail freight traffic increased by 10 per cent in the year 2025

release

According to Statistics Finland, 89.7 million trips in passenger traffic were made and 29.2 million tonnes of freight were transported by Finnish rail in 2025. The number of trips in passenger traffic grew by six per cent compared to the previous year. The volume of freight transport increased by 10 per cent.

Key selections

  • In 2025, altogether 5 million more trips in passenger traffic by rail were made than in 2024. The number of passengers in local traffic increased by six per cent and that in long-distance traffic by five per cent.
  • The transport performance of freight transport totalled 8.5 billion tonne-kilometres, which was three per cent more than in 2024.
  • Eight persons died and two person were seriously injured in railway accidents. The number of deaths and serious injuries doubled from preceding year.
  • The share of the electric tractive stock in train-kilometres rose to 92 per cent. The train-kilometres increased three per cent for electric locomotive and nine per cent for electric railcars.
